Cita:
Empezado por coso
Ten en cuenta por eso, que al cambiar KeyValue estaras cambiando el valor en la base de datos correspondiente a KeyField. saludos.
|
Hola coso, que yo sepa no cambia en valor en la BD. Digamos que nuestro KeyField es el campo Codigo, si asiganmos al KeyValue el codigo 2 "DBLookupComboBox1.KeyValue := '2';", lo que hara es seleccionar ese item en nuestro DBLookupComboBox, como le estamos pasando vacio '', al no encontrar, no selecciona nada y lo deja como estaba al principio.
Saluditos